PANT WARNS OF DANGEROUS IMITATION “ASPIRIN” FOUND IN YAVAPAI COUNTY

PRESCOTT ARIZONA (April 21, 2023) –Partner’s Against Narcotics Trafficking (PANT) is warning the public of dangerous imitation “aspirin” that has been found in the area. In two recent cases, white round pills with no identifiers were discovered. Upon testing, the pills were found to contain Xylazine and acetaminophen; Xylazine, is a pharmaceutical drug typically used for sedation and anesthesia in animals such as horses and cattle.

The US has seen a recent rise in the recreational use of Xylazine, and PANT is warning citizens to be aware of any suspicious pills they may come across.
